This guide offers a thorough look at the process, requirements, and ideas for passing the Hungarian driving test, along with frequently asked questions that can clarify common doubts.Understanding the Hungarian Driving TestThe Hungarian driving test consists of 2 primary parts: a theoretical test and a useful driving test. It is essential to pass both parts to get the driver's license. Theoretical TestThe theoretical test assesses your knowledge of traffic rules, road indications, and safe driving practices. It is typically conducted in a multiple-choice format.Variety of Questions: 30 Passing Grade: 75% (you should properly respond to at least 22 questions)Time Limit: 45 minutesLanguages Available: Hungarian, English, German, and other languages depending on the testing centerPractical Driving TestThe practical driving test evaluates your driving abilities in real traffic conditions. A certified inspector will accompany you throughout this portion of the test.What to Expect:Duration: Approximately 30-45 minutes.Driving Maneuvers: You will be examined on different driving skills, such as parallel parking, reversing, and browsing through intersections.Common Routes: Test paths might consist of a mix of urban and rural roadways.Requirements for Taking the TestBefore you can take the driving test, you need to meet particular requirements and submit essential documents.RequirementDetailsAgeMinimum 17 years for a classification B license (automobile)ResidencyLegitimate Hungarian address or foreign home permitMedical ClearanceCertificate from a doctor validating fitness to driveTheoretical CourseConclusion of a theoretical training course, typically used by driving schoolsPractical TrainingA minimum of 30 hours of behind-the-wheel training with an instructorGetting ready for the Driving TestPreparation is key to successfully passing the Hungarian driving test. How many times can I retake the driving test?You can take the theoretical or dry run multiple times; nevertheless, a waiting duration of 30 days is normally enforced after failing either test.2. Can I take driving lessons in English?Yes, numerous driving schools in Hungary provide courses in various languages, consisting of English.3. Is it possible to switch my foreign driver's license for a Hungarian one?EU nationals can exchange their licenses without additional tests. Non-EU people might have to take the complete testing process.4. What are the expenses associated with the driving test?Expenses can differ commonly, however normally, the overall cost (consisting of lessons and assessment fees) can vary from HUF 300,000 to HUF 500,000. 5. How long does a Hungarian driver's license last?A basic Hungarian driver's license stands for 10 years.
